Information requested

Regarding the £400,000 donation made to Pakistan by the Scottish Government. Since foreign aid is an area reserved to the UK government, I assume this donation must have come from one of the Scottish Government's devolved budgets. I would be grateful if you could tell me which budget this donation has come from.

Response

Thank you for your email on 16 March 2019 regarding the £400,000 scholarship funding for women and girls in Pakistan. The £400,000 funding for the Pakistan Scholarships is through our International Development Fund as part of our established International Development programme within the Culture, Tourism and External Affairs portfolio.
